GLOVER v. STATE

No. 4D01-4757.

816 So.2d 1173 (2002)

Billy John GLOVER, Appellant, v. STATE of Florida,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Fourth District.

May 8, 2002.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Billy John Glover, Crestview, pro se.

Robert A. Butterworth, Attorney General, Tallahassee, and Marrett W. Hanna, Assistant Attorney General, West Palm Beach, for appellee.


PER CURIAM.

This is an appeal from an order denying appellant's rule 3.850 motion which we treat as a 3.800 motion, asserting that his sentence as a violent career criminal, under section 775.084(4)(c), Florida Statutes (1995), is illegal because the statute was held unconstitutional in State v.
